Sinking Foundation Repair in New Britain, CT
Sinking foundation repair services address issues caused by uneven settling or shifting of a property's foundation, which can lead to structural instability, uneven floors, cracked walls, and other damage. These repairs typically involve stabilizing and lifting the foundation through various methods such as underpinning, piering, or mudjacking, depending on the specific circumstances of the project. Common Sinking Foundation Repair Jobs
Residential foundation repairs address uneven or cracked foundations to stabilize homes.
Basement sinking correction involves lifting and leveling basement floors affected by shifting soil.
Pier and beam foundation stabilization prevents further settling and structural issues.
Concrete slab lifting restores sunken concrete surfaces like driveways and walkways.
Soil stabilization services improve ground support to reduce future foundation movement.
Foundation wall reinforcement helps prevent bowing and cracking of basement walls.
Sinking Foundation Repair Questions
What causes a sinking foundation? Soil movement, poor drainage, and changes in moisture levels can lead to foundation sinking over time.
How can I tell if my foundation is sinking?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, and sticking doors or windows.
Is foundation sinking a serious problem? Yes, it can affect the stability of a property and lead to further structural issues if not addressed.
What types of repair methods are used for sinking foundations? Techniques include underpinning, slab jacking, and pier installation to stabilize and lift the foundation.
